  I know it's a kludge, but I just cron'ed rhn-profile-sync on my client 
systems. I had the same issue, and after a few days of research couldn't 
find an answer.

Sorry I'm of little help, just wanted to let you know you aren't alone 
with this issue.

> On 10-11-30 03:26 AM, Michael Mraka wrote:
>> Michael Morel wrote:
>> % Running Spacewalk 1.2 and everything seems to be good except my
>> % clients are not updating their package lists.
>> % The All show "System is up to date".  rhnsd is running on the client
>> % and if I run rhn-profile-sync then everything
>> % updates and it shows that the client needs updates.  Shouldn`t this
>> % be happening automagically?
>>
>> Yes, it should.
>> Just to be clear: The system overview page in spacewalk says "System is
>> up to date" but manual yum update on the system shows there packages to
>> update. And after manual rhn-profile-sync on the system also overview page in
>> spacewalk shows updates available, right?
>>
>> How did you get packages into channels - via rhnpush, spacewalk-repo-sync
>> or satellite-sync?
